Ephemeral messages in LINE for Android

The Japanese messaging app Reservation It arrived in our country positioning itself as one of the best alternatives to whatsapp Thanks to its blend of chat app and social network. It also included a system of stickers which caused a sensation at the time of its launch. However, over time many users have abandoned the application after the appearance of other systems such as Snapchat on Android.

Now LINE is looking at one of its most direct competitors to try to recover a large part of its lost users and is presenting the ephemeral messagesThis new feature is currently exclusive to Google's operating system. After its latest update, the application will include messages that disappear after 24 hours.

The update, which will arrive first on Android in the coming days, will allow users to flag a post before it is published. self destruction after a day. To do this, simply click on the clock icon which appears in the upper right corner when preparing a new publication.

The concept of content that expires 24 hours after being published is what made an app as well-known today as Snapchat famous, which has gradually been gaining ground on other popular apps such as TwitterFacebook Messenger or LINE, the app that is now looking to it to present this new feature.

This isn't the only new feature coming to LINE on Android after the latest update. In version 6.8.0 Fun effects for the Android app are coming to the video callsThis way, we can add fun filters to our image while talking to any contact, filters very much in the style of… Snapchat.

Go for Snapchat

This new feature from LINE isn't the first clue that the instant messaging app intends to become more like Snapchat on Android. The developers behind the social network, or instant messaging app, have already invested 40 millones de euros in buying an app with services very similar to those of Snapchat, for which the app has become famous: Snow.

LINE's ephemeral posts on Android

Posts that disappear from the Timeline

LINE's integrated social network, its TimelineIt has been gaining prominence. What began almost as an anecdote is now a space for sharing thoughtsPhotos, stickers, and links to friends. With ephemeral messages, in addition to the buttons for composing a post, there are also new clock buttonWhen you press it, the publication only stays online It lasts for 24 hours and then automatically deletes itself without leaving a visible trace. It is not possible to choose a different duration: the timeframe is fixed.

In addition, the Timeline receives other improvements that facilitate its daily use: now you can link directly to specific publications and save erasers to continue later. It also enhances search by tags to locate past posts that have been tagged, with results limited to public posts.

Privacy: secret chats, timers, and encryption

LINE had already experimented with the idea of ​​the ephemeral in the past through secret chats with timers similar to those of other apps. In those chats, it was possible to set a self-destruct time. from seconds to a weekOnce the time had elapsed, the message would disappear from the chat window and the service's servers. This feature was removed when the platform extended the end-to-end encryption to all conversations.

Today, end-to-end encryption protects chats by default (unless disabled), while ephemeral Timeline posts provide privacy by design On a social level. It's worth remembering that, even though the content is deleted after 24 hours, nothing prevents a recipient from making a screenshot; best practice It's about not sharing anything you wouldn't share in a private chat.

Effects in video calls: filters and expressions

The video calls LINE also receives a boost with real-time effects applicable to your face, without additional apps. To activate them, tap the emoji icon at the bottom of the screen during the call. The effects may not be available on all devices, as they depend on the hardware and version.

You'll find two main types of new features: on the one hand, filters that modify the colorimetry for a more elegant or fun look; on the other hand, masks and expressions that react to your gesture with hearts, angry tones, and other animations to add more expressiveness to the conversation. These features They arrive first on Android and will later be extended to iOS.
